CE Please read the entire manual before assembling or operating the equipment In particular note the following safety precautions to reduce the likelihood of injury 0 NO 1 Children must be supervised at all times and never left unattended with the unit 2 3 Place the equipment on level ground not less than 6 ft 1 8 m from any structure or Make sure the surfaces are free of objects that may cause tipping over obstruction such as fence garage house overhanging branches laundry lines or electrical wires Make sure bystanders are at least 5 feet away from the equipment while it is in motion No one should be allowed to walk close to in front of behind or between moving items Do not sit on the end or stand on the Lounge Rocker This could cause the Lounge Rocker to tip over and result in injury The Lounge Rocker is not designed to use by children Maximum user weight is 300 Ibs Only one person should be using the Lounge Rocker at a time Care and Maintenance Periodically inspect all parts Check all bolts twice monthly during the usage season for tightness and tighten as required It is particularly important that this procedure be followed at the beginning of each season Replace any worn and damaged part immediately Check all bolts and sharp edges twice monthly during usage season to be certain they are in place Replace when necessary It is especially important to do this at the beginning
